A Man to Remember 1938
A Man to Remember
On the day of his funeral, a dedicated smalltown doctor is remembered by his neighbors and patients.

A satisfying story about a physician who serves humanity in spite of it not being very profitable. He witnesses greed, vanity and corruption in the "respectable" citizens of his town. Despite being poor, shattered dreams and being cheated, he is rewarded at the end, if perhaps in a small way.
